    Understanding Regulatory Compliance in AI

    Regulatory compliance in AI refers to adhering to laws, regulations, ethical principles, and industry standards governing the development and use of AI technologies. Compliance ensures that AI systems are:

    • Transparent and accountable
    • Secure and reliable
    • Free from harmful bias
    • Protective of user privacy
    • Aligned with local and international legal requirements

    As governments worldwide continue to introduce AI-related regulations, organizations need robust governance frameworks to manage AI risks effectively.

    Key Steps Organizations Take to Ensure AI Compliance

    1. Establishing AI Governance Policies

    Organizations begin by creating clear AI governance policies that define:

    • Ethical AI principles
    • Data handling requirements
    • Risk management procedures
    • Accountability structures
    • Human oversight mechanisms

    These policies help ensure that AI systems are developed and operated responsibly.

    2. Conducting Risk Assessments

    AI systems can introduce operational, legal, and ethical risks. Organizations perform regular AI risk assessments to identify:

    • Algorithmic bias
    • Data privacy concerns
    • Security vulnerabilities
    • Compliance gaps
    • Potential misuse of AI systems

    Risk assessments allow businesses to take proactive corrective actions before issues arise.

    3. Implementing Data Privacy and Security Controls

    AI systems rely heavily on data. To ensure compliance, organizations implement strong cybersecurity and privacy measures, including:

    • Data encryption
    • Access control management
    • Secure data storage
    • Consent management
    • Continuous monitoring

    These controls help organizations comply with data protection regulations and safeguard sensitive information.

    4. Maintaining Transparency and Accountability

    Transparency is critical in AI governance. Organizations ensure compliance by documenting:

    • AI decision-making processes
    • Data sources
    • Model training methodologies
    • System updates and modifications

    Clear documentation improves accountability and supports regulatory audits.

    5. Continuous Monitoring and Auditing

    AI compliance is not a one-time activity. Organizations continuously monitor AI systems to evaluate performance, fairness, and legal compliance. Internal audits and regular reviews help identify areas for improvement and maintain ongoing compliance.

    The Role of ISO 42001 in AI Compliance

    ISO 42001 provides a globally recognized framework for managing AI responsibly. It helps organizations establish, implement, maintain, and improve AI management systems.
